PULASKI, Tenn. – The University of Tennessee Southern baseball team closed out the weekend series with the Rams of the University of Mobile on Friday. The Firehawks took game two 6-4 and fell in game three 11-5. UTS improved to 12-23 overall and 4-14 in league play on the season.
GAME TWO: UTS 6, UM 4
Cole Barnett got the Firehawks ignited in the second with a two run shot to left center. His blast scored
Gage Beckner. Later in the inning,
Cannon Raby lifted one out over the center field wall. His moonshot scored
Evan Nelson and
Mason Billions. UTS led 5-0 after two.
In the third, Barnett hit a solo shot to center. UTS left 6-0 after three.
Mobile had a big inning in the fourth plating four runs.
Ridge Raper (2-6) tossed the complete game allowing one earned run. He gave up nine hits and struck out six.
GAME THREE: UM 11, UTS 5
Brayden Buckner reached on a fielder's choice that created a scoring opportunity off a Ram error. Raby scored on the miscue. UTS led 1-0 after one.
Mobile scored three runs in the top of the third. The Firehawks added three of their own to retake the lead. Buckner hit a sacrifice fly driving in
Devin Buckhalter. Barnett singled to left center driving in Raby.
Collin Perkins hit a ground ball plating
Cody Womble. UTS lef 4-3 heading to the fourth.
Mobile added two in the fifth and six in the sixth to lead 11-4.
Womble singled to right in the eighth driving in Raby.
Chambers McGilberry (3-5) tossed five innings allowing four earned runs and striking out seven.
Barrett Brown and
Jackson Moon tossed the sixth. They allowed six runs combined.
Austin Uptain worked 1.1 innings issuing one free pass.
Zach Neill tossed one inning allowing one hit.
Cooper Bailey recorded the final two outs fanning one Ram hitter.
